Project development

During July, I took part to the international project paint in colours El Saucejo (Seville, Spain).

We, guys from all the world, dedicated our time creating murals for local people.

We worked with the volunteering organizations de Amicitia and Yap (Youth Action for Peace),
in collaboration with the tawn hall of the ciy.

We started working together and exchanged our ideas. Once we had made different sketches, the institutions involved chose and approved some of them.

1. Kindergarten El Saucejo

Education by art

We have realized this painting paying attention to the educative aspect of the art.

The teachers asked us to create something to teach the children the basilar forms, shapes, letters, numbers. We did it with fantasy and a lot of colours.

What comes up is that the children start learning numbers, letters and so on having fun. In this way, it’s easier to learn and to remember the concepts because the associations between the concepts and the images remain longer in the mind of the children.

 

2. Secondary school Flavio Irnitano

Tu actitud decide tu camino

 

The respect begins from us

Your life is the consequence of your actions

When the guys of the Secondary school saw what we were doing at the kindergarten, they desired their own murals in the class of the Insitute. We decided to make them a surprise.

We wanted the guys to receive a message of Peace and Integration, so we paint the P-sign and a puzzle made by hands.

We also wanted them to understand that everyone has the enormous power of choice. “Tu actitud decide tu camino” means that you chose who you are by your actions, so you have the responsibility of your future.
